Jandor Debunks Claims Of APC Backing Any Governorship Aspirant
Abdul-Azeez Adediran, also known as Jandor, is an All Progressives Congress (APC) candidate running for governor of Lagos in 2027. He has said that the party has not selected a consensus candidate.
Jandor said that no such decision has been made by the party leadership in a statement signed by his spokesperson, Gbenga Ogunleye.
We restate, in line with the official position of the Lagos State APC leadership as communicated by the State Chairman, that no aspirant has been anointed and that all aspirants will participate in a credible primary election,” the statement reads.
The aspirant, however, said if the party’s leadership resolves to adopt a consensus candidacy, he “will fully align with that decision, irrespective of who emerges”.
“This is a position anchored on his readiness to compete, and a willingness to submit to the collective will of the party,” the statement reads.
“JANDOR urges party members not to mistake a campaign by an individual or a political group for their choice aspirant as the party position or that of our Leader. When the party and our Leader speak, I am sure no one will do otherwise,” the statement reads.
